Applied Therapeutics Reports First Quarter 2024 Financial Results

 

-      Govorestat NDA for Classic Galactosemia under Priority Review, PDUFA target action date of November 28, 2024

 

-      Govorestat MAA under review by EMA; Day 120 3-month clock-stop extension granted; decision expected in early Q1 2025

 

-      Company discussing potential NDA submission under Accelerated Approval for govorestat for treatment of SORD Deficiency with Neurology I Division of FDA

 

NEW YORK, May 9, 2024 – Applied Therapeutics, Inc. (Nasdaq: APLT) (the “Company”), a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company developing a pipeline of novel drug candidates against validated molecular targets in indications of high unmet medical need, today reported financial results for the first quarter ended March 31, 2024.

 

“Preparations are underway for the potential approval and commercial launch of govorestat for the treatment of Classic Galactosemia in the US and EU, following the significant regulatory progress we have already made in 2024,” said Shoshana Shendelman, PhD, Founder and CEO of Applied Therapeutics. “We are also discussing a potential NDA submission for SORD Deficiency with the Neurology Division at FDA, further advancing our objective of bringing first ever treatment to patients with rare diseases.”

 

Recent Highlights

 

·Govorestat NDA Under Priority Review by US FDA for Treatment of Classic Galactosemia, PDUFA Target Action Date of November 28, 2024; MAA under CHMP Review by EMA. In March 2024, the Company announced that the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has extended the review period for the New Drug Application (NDA) for govorestat (AT-007) for the treatment of Classic Galactosemia to allow more time to review supplemental analyses of previously submitted data that had been provided by Applied in response to the FDA’s routine information requests. No additional data or studies have been requested by the FDA at this time. The new PDUFA action date is November 28, 2024. The NDA was granted Priority Review Status, and the FDA also noted that it plans to hold an advisory committee meeting to discuss the application. Govorestat was previously granted Pediatric Rare Disease designation and will qualify for a Priority Review Voucher (PRV) upon approval. The Company has also submitted a Marketing Authorization Application (MAA) for govorestat for the treatment of Classic Galactosemia to the European Medicines Agency (EMA), which was validated in December 2023 and is under review by the EMA’s Committee for Medicinal Products for Human Use (CHMP). In April 2024, the EMA granted a 3-month extension to the Day 120 clock stop period to allow sufficient time for responses to the CHMP’s Day 120 list of questions. As a result, the Company now expects a decision by the EMA in early first quarter of 2025. The NDA and MAA submission packages include clinical outcomes data from the Phase 3 registrational ACTION-Galactosemia Kids study in children aged 2-17 with Galactosemia, the Phase 1/2 ACTION-Galactosemia study in adult patients with Galactosemia, and preclinical data.

·Presented Full Results from Phase 3 ARISE-HF Study of AT-001 (caficrestat) in Diabetic Cardiomyopathy at the 2024 American College of Cardiology Annual Scientific Session. In April 2024, the Company presented full results from the Phase 3 ARISE-HF study of AT-001 in patients with diabetic cardiomyopathy (DbCM) in an oral presentation at the 2024 American College of Cardiology (ACC) Annual Scientific Session. In the ARISE-HF study, treatment with AT-001 demonstrated a strong trend in stabilizing cardiac functional capacity, and a statistically significant difference in cardiac functional capacity in a prespecified subgroup of patients not receiving concomitant treatment with an SGLT2 or GLP-1 while preventing clinically significant worsening. Furthermore, AT-001 treatment prevented progression to overt heart failure in patients with DbCM as compared to placebo (p=0.0285). Data also demonstrated that AT-001 was safe and well tolerated in a large cohort of patients, providing proof of concept that the technology has overcome the selectivity and safety issues of “old” aldose reductase inhibitors. Following the presentation, the full study results were published in the Journal of the American College of Cardiology (JACC).

 

Financial Results

 

·Cash and cash equivalents and short-term investments totaled $146.5 million as of March 31, 2024, compared with $49.9 million at December 31, 2023.

 

·Research and development expenses for the three months ended March 31, 2024, were $12.2 million, compared to $15.9 million for the three months ended March 31, 2023. The decrease of approximately $3.7 million was primarily attributed to decreased expenses related to contract research organizations (CROs) and drug manufacturing and formulation costs, partially offset by an increase in regulatory and personnel expenses.

 

·General and administrative expenses were $9.1 million for the three months ended March 31, 2024, compared to $5.6 million for the three months ended March 31, 2023. The increase of approximately $3.5 million was primarily related to an increase in legal and professional fees of $1.2 million and $1.4 million in commercial expenses to support planned commercialization of govorestat, and an increase in other expenses of $0.9 million due to an overall increase in data storage costs to support planned commercialization.

 

·Net loss for the first quarter of 2024 was $83.9 million, or $0.67 per basic and diluted common share, compared to a net loss of $10.1 million, or $0.18 per basic and diluted common share, for the first quarter 2023.

 

·Cash runway: The Company expects that its cash and cash equivalents will fund the business into 2026. Additionally, the sale of the priority review voucher (PRV), which would be granted upon a potential NDA approval of govorestat for the treatment of Galactosemia could substantially extend the Company’s cash runway.

 

 

 

 

About Applied Therapeutics

 

Applied Therapeutics is a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company developing a pipeline of novel drug candidates against validated molecular targets in indications of high unmet medical need. The Company’s lead drug candidate, govorestat, is a novel central nervous system penetrant Aldose Reductase Inhibitor (ARI) for the treatment of CNS rare metabolic diseases, including Galactosemia, SORD Deficiency, and PMM2-CDG. The Company is also developing AT-001, a novel potent ARI, for the treatment of Diabetic Cardiomyopathy, or DbCM, a fatal fibrosis of the heart. The preclinical pipeline also includes AT-003, an ARI designed to cross through the back of the eye when dosed orally, for the treatment of Diabetic retinopathy.
